TBM11870433 Double-sided Key Block for Ukiyo-e Print, c.1830 (cherry wood) by Kunisada, Utagawa (Toyokuni III) (1786-1865); 19.1 x 24.1 cm; Brooklyn Museum, New York, USA; (add.info.: Utagawa Kunisada (Toyokuni III) (side a), Japanese, 1786-1865, Eisen Keisai (side b), Japanese, 1790-1848. Double-sided Key Block for Ukiyo-e Print, ca. 1830. Cherry wood, 15 1/2 x 10 1/8 x 3/8 in. (39.4 x 25.7 x 1 cm). Asian Art. Tool. Place made: Japan, Asia); © Brooklyn Museum.
